So, the saying; the best knife is the one you have on you, is not always entirely correct. Today I'm carrying my Squirt ES4, because I like to carry in my watch pocket, and the pants of the day has really shallow pockets, so the squirt is the only knife in my lineup that conceals. I like the Squirt, but prefer a locking blade and always carry such when pocket space allows.
I never feel safe with non-locking blades and I always find it strange when reviewers trivialize this fact when reviewing non-locking blades, especially EDC blades that you have to use for whatever situation that might arise.
So back to the squirt, when the need for a knife arose earlier today, I knew the squirt wouldn't be the best knife for the task, but it was right there in my pocket, and laziness prevented me from getting a proper knife. As I've always worried about, today the knife closed on me while applying a fair amount of pressure, resulting in a nice and deep cut in my thumb.
So thats just my heads up to any other lazy EDC'ers out there.
No need to point out my stupidness here, I'm fully aware, and only blame myself.
